ian의 개발일기장

[Easy] Drawing Book 본문

Algorithms/HackerRank

[Easy] Drawing Book

ian90 2018. 11. 9. 00:31













1. 나의 풀이


1~n까지 모든 페이지를 구해서, indexOf를 이용하여 찾고자하는 p페이지의 인덱스를 찾는다. 인덱스를 2로 나눈 몫으로 몇번페이지를 넘겼나 알 수 있다. 다만, 앞에서부터 페이지를 찾을 때, 1페이지가 1면만 있기 때문에, 인덱스에 1을 더해주어야 한다. n페이지가 짝수이면, 맨마지막 페이지도 1면만 있기 때문에 인덱스에 1을 더해주고, 아니면 더해주지않았다.



2. 정리


array.indexOf(인덱스를 찾을 원소)



출처 - HackerRankMDN공식문서



'Algorithms > HackerRank' 카테고리의 다른 글

[Easy] Electronics Shop  (0) 2018.11.21
[Easy] Migratory Birds  (0) 2018.11.07
[Easy] Sock Merchant  (0) 2018.11.03
[Easy] Bon Appetit  (0) 2018.11.02
[Easy] A Very Big Sum  (0) 2018.10.27